Note for Graduate Credit you must complete a project in addition to completeing course.

Graduate Course Requirements

1) Attend and actively participate in 30 hours of teacher workshop sessions.

2) Develop a research paper where you will develop a full lesson plan that incorporates one of the workshop topics of a Unit. 

The research paper should include the following:

  • Short Introduction, where you outline the topic chosen and indicate how you will develop it.
  • Review and Reflection on the whole workshop series.
  • Content summary of the topic you chose for your lesson plan.  Here you clearly set forth your understanding of the science topic that you have chosen for your lesson plan. 
  • ****Include considerably more detail than you are actually going to teach.
  • Lesson Plan
      NYS Standards addressedLesson Plan agreeded upon with Graduate ProfessorLaboratory Component
    or HW assigned with answers
    • Assessment
    • Student Notes and Handouts
  • Conclusion, where you summarize what you hope to achieve and close out the paper.

Research paper is Due 14 days after completion of course. All papers are emailed as a pdf to Professor Langella, your graduate professor at langella@pwista.com.
